Sales further alleged that Iranian forces were \u201ctrying to lay mines to block the Strait of Hormuz\u201d and were threatening US troops in the region. \u201cSo, this was entirely in self-defence. If the Iranians are concerned about the fragility of the cease-fire, they can take a good look in the mirror,\u201d he said.<\/p>\n<p>According to an AP report, the US military described May 25 strikes in southern Iran as \u201cdefensive\u201d in nature. The report said the targets included missile launch sites and minelaying boats, while Washington insisted it had acted with \u201crestraint\u201d despite heightened tensions during the ceasefire. The strikes marked another escalation in the conflict, even as negotiations reportedly continued toward a broader agreement to end hostilities and reopen regional trade routes.<\/p>\n<p>Iran, however, sharply criticised the attacks and accused Washington of acting in \u201cbad faith and unreliability\u201d, AP reported.
